Description
Photograph of the Parmelee-Dohrmann Company on Spring Street between Third and Fourth Streets, 1900. A road lies in the foreground while bicycles stand parked along the sidewalk on its far side. Two people walk along the sidewalk beneath the shade of the large awning that protrudes from the Parmalee-Dohrmann Co. building. Other stores stand on either side of the building.

Description
The nearly 15,000 unique photographs of this collection contain the work of C.C. Pierce which cover the Los Angeles region city, street and architectural views, California Missions, Southwestern Native Americans, and turn-of-century Nevada, Arizona, and California. Pierce, active from 1886 to 1940, was one of the leading photographers of his day and amassed a collection of 15,000 images, including his own and those bought and copied from his contemporaries, George Wharton James and Charles Puck. The James collection contains over 2,000 images of portraits, customs, ceremonies, arts, and games of various groups of Southwestern Native Americans.
